Inadequate Flashing Installation
Choosing the right materials isn't the only factor that can lead to roof covering issues; poor flashing setup can likewise produce substantial concerns. Flashing is critical for directing water away from vulnerable areas, such as smokeshafts, skylights, and roof valleys. If it's not set up correctly, you risk water invasion, which can cause mold growth and structural damages.
When you set up flashing, guarantee it's the right type for your roof's design and the local climate. As an example, steel blinking is usually extra sturdy than plastic in areas with heavy rain or snow. Make certain the flashing overlaps suitably and is secured firmly to stop spaces where water can seep with.
You should likewise focus on the installment angle. Blinking must be placed to route water far from the house, not towards it.

Neglecting Ventilation Requirements
While lots of homeowners concentrate on the visual and structural facets of roof covering setup, ignoring ventilation needs can bring about serious long-lasting effects. Proper air flow is vital for regulating temperature and wetness degrees in your attic room, stopping concerns like mold and mildew growth, timber rot, and ice dams. If you do not install ample ventilation, you're setting your roof up for failing.
To avoid this blunder, initially, evaluate your home's certain ventilation requirements. A well balanced system commonly consists of both consumption and exhaust vents to promote air flow. Ensure you've installed soffit vents along the eaves and ridge vents at the top of your roofing system. This mix enables hot air to escape while cooler air goes into, keeping your attic room area comfortable.
Also, think about the kind of roof product you have actually chosen. Some materials might need extra air flow strategies. Double-check your regional building regulations for air flow standards, as they can differ significantly.
